Summary for Parents
Overview
- •Mazzarello School in Shillong is a well-regarded ICSE school known for its disciplined environment, caring teachers, and focus on moral education. It offers a balanced approach to academics and co-curricular activities, though the campus size and limited transport routes are worth noting.
What kind of child will this school work for best
- •- A child who thrives in a structured and disciplined environment
- •- A student who enjoys academics and values-based learning
- •- A child who prefers a close-knit school community
Strengths
- •- Strong academic foundation under ICSE curriculum
- •- Dedicated and experienced teachers
- •- Emphasis on discipline and moral values
- •- Clean and safe campus environment
Potential trade-offs / Things to check
- •- Limited playground space
- •- Transport coverage not extensive
- •- Communication with parents could be more frequent
- •- Strict rules may not suit every child

What Parents Say
Aggregated from parent reviews across platforms. Ask these questions during your school visit.
Academics
Positives
Parents appreciate the strong ICSE curriculum and the teachers’ commitment to ensuring students understand concepts well.
Watch out for
Some parents feel that the academic pressure can be high, especially in higher classes.
Ask: How does the school support students who need extra academic help?
Discipline & Values
Positives
The school is known for instilling discipline and moral values, which many parents find reassuring.
Watch out for
A few parents mentioned that the rules can feel strict for younger children.
Ask: How does the school balance discipline with emotional well-being?
Infrastructure
Positives
The classrooms and labs are well maintained, and the school is clean and organized.
Watch out for
The campus size is relatively small, limiting outdoor sports options.
Ask: Are there plans to expand sports or outdoor facilities?
Communication
Positives
Teachers are approachable and responsive during parent-teacher meetings.
Watch out for
Some parents wish for more frequent updates through digital platforms.
Ask: Does the school have an online parent communication system?
Co-curricular Activities
Positives
Students get opportunities in music, dance, and cultural events.
Watch out for
Sports options are somewhat limited due to space constraints.
Ask: What extracurricular programs are available beyond academics?
